Methode Introduces Its New Screen Printable Polymer Thick Film Silver Ink with Extremely High Conductivity and Low Temperature Curing


CHICAGO, IL - Methode Development Company, a subsidiary of Methode Electronics, Inc., introduces its new highly conductive 6105 Silver Conductor Ink. This extremely conductive ink allows for aggressive miniaturization and increased functionality in electronic circuitry. These performance results were previously possible only with use of high temperature ceramic firing inks or subtractive metal foil circuits.

The 6105 Silver Conductive Ink offers 5 milliohms per square, per mil resistance, which exceeds typical conductive silver inks by more than a factor of 5. The ink is ideal for use in applications such as cellular communications, telecommunications, consumer electronics, RFID antennas, Smart Cards, GPS, Bluetooth/WiFi, and automotive electronics.

6105 ink can be used on a number of substrates including: Polyester, Polyimide, other plastics, coated paper, and FR-4 - which, with its relatively low cure requirements, can be cured or dried in standard convection ovens or IR ovens. Lower resistance can be achieved by using higher temperature cure profiles with substrates that can withstand such high temperatures.

Methode Development Company's new silver ink delivers low resistivity, stable physical and electrical properties, and a generous processing window based on substrate material. Shelf life in unopened jars is six months when stored at room temperature. The ink is RoHS compliant since it contains no materials on the RoHS banned list.
